Blažo Jovanović Bridge is a bridge across the Morača river in Podgorica, Montenegro. The bridge is located near the confluence of the Ribnica and Morača rivers and is part of the Saint Peter of Cetinje Boulevard. It is 115.20m long and 22.35m wide and the city's busiest bridge.

In stereochemistry, a torsion angle is defined as a particular example of a dihedral angle, describing the geometric relation of two parts of a molecule joined by a chemical bond. Every set of three non-colinear atoms of a molecule defines a half-plane. As explained above, when two such half-planes intersect, the angle between them is a dihedral angle. Dihedral angles are used to specify the molecular conformation. Stereochemical arrangements corresponding to angles between 0° and ±90° are called syn (s), those corresponding to angles between ±90° and 180° anti (a). Similarly, arrangements corresponding to angles between 30° and 150° or between −30° and −150° are called clinal (c) and those between 0° and ±30° or ±150° and 180° are called periplanar (p).
